The DIA7875 is a low-dropout linear regulator designed to function with a wide input voltage range from 3 V to 40 V. The 3 V minimum operation voltage allows DIA7875 to function normally during cold-crank and start and stop conditions. With only 4 µA ultra-low quiescent current at no load, the DIA7875 is quite suitable for microcontrollers and CAN/LIN transceivers power supply in standby systems. The DIA7875 integrates short-circuit and overcurrent protection. The device operates in ambient temperatures from -40°C to 125°C and with junction temperatures from -40°C to 150°C, which enables the DIA7875 to be used in the harsh automotive environment. This device uses a thermally conductive package to enable sustained operation despite significant dissipation across the device.
Product attributes
- AEC-Q100 qualified:
Device ambient temperature: -40°C ≤ TA ≤ 125°C
Device junction temperature: -40°C ≤ TJ ≤ 150°C
- 3 V to 40 V wide input voltage range with up to 45 V transient
- Operating output voltage range: 1.2 V to 5 V
- Low quiescent current:
4 µA typical at no load
Maximum output current: 350 mA
±2% output voltage accuracy over temperature
Typical dropout voltage: 500 mV at 350 mA load current for 5 V output version
- Stable with low equivalent series resistance
ceramic output-stability capacitor
